I'm having the following problem with Knoppix 6.2 since commit 
a65f417c8430ce6781cbbfe84381a97d60628d81 of seabios:

Linux Call trace and AMD pcnet network interface doesn't work. Looks like 
that interrupt is disabled.

I bisect it down to the following commit:
a65f417c8430ce6781cbbfe84381a97d60628d81 is the first bad commit
commit a65f417c8430ce6781cbbfe84381a97d60628d81
Author: Kevin O'Connor <kevin at koconnor.net>
Date:   Sun Sep 25 23:08:58 2011 -0400

     Consolidate DSDT copy-and-paste PCI IRQ code into method calls.

     Use method calls in LNK[ABCDS] object methods - this reduces the
     cut-and-paste code.  It also makes it simpler and the object size
     smaller.

     Signed-off-by: Kevin O'Connor <kevin at koconnor.net>

Any ideas what the problem might be and how to fix it?
